Funny that you say the Kioti was "pricey." You say you paid $18,944 for your 3032E with the 72" blade and 60" brush cutter.
Your first thread said you got a quote of $19,699 for a Kioti CK35SE HST with a 60" brush cutter, and 60" blade. The Kioti weighs 1K more than your Deere, has 400lbs more 3pt lift, 25% more PTO HP, 3 range HST versus 2, and the FEL goes 10" with the same (within a few pounds) max lift capacity.
You simply got less tractor capability, and only saved $700. If you're happy with that, nobody can fault you, but to call a more capable machine "pricey" when it's basically the same cost isn't really fair to someone who might be reading this, and not know better.
